Transaction e7957563aeba8c8a54c99ac7670b1be756a3c3abd7b85e4b6bf7cfd0719a9323

block
88392008795be14f5710d534a171516ebfcb9c2ffc12e139a92d299947287d63

1 Input

2 Outputs